摘要
This paper introduces urban ecosystem health theory into ecological city, starting from the connotation of ecosystem health in urban, combined with the actual situation of Nanjing, then established Nanjing urban ecosystem health evaluation index system. Based on the theory of dissipative structure and information entropy and combined entropy change and information entropy, apply the information entropy theory to analyze Nanjing urban ecosystem health. Research shows: Nanjing urban ecosystem health index has been on the rise as a whole from 1999 to 2012, which suggested that the Nanjing urban ecosystem health has improved year by year, but the urban ecosystem health index is low that suggests sick and unhealthy. From the point of the internal composition of urban ecosystem, Nanjing urban economic system, social system and natural environment of health index is low. The sustainable development ability of Nanjing urban ecological system is not strong and the urban ecosystem health level remains to be further improved. © 2015 CAFET-INNOVA TECHNICAL SOCIETY.
